I. Overview of DQA and DQE
In today's highly competitive market environment, product quality is the foundation for an enterprise to gain a foothold. DQA (Design Quality Assurance) and DQE (Design Quality engineer, also known as design quality engineer) play a crucial role in ensuring product quality. DQA gets involved from the concept phase of a project and runs through the entire product development stage. Its core objective is to enable quality engineers to integrate quality factors into the design to ensure the reliability of products. Take AAEON as an example. All products of the company must undergo safety and environmental tests in the laboratory to ensure compliance with standards such as CE/UL/FCC/CCC. At the same time, the products also need to go through a comprehensive and extensive test plan, covering multiple aspects such as compatibility, functionality, performance, and usability.
II. Professional knowledge and skills that DQE needs to master
(I) Process and Document Management
1. Continuously improving the product design and development process and work methods is one of the important responsibilities of DQE. An efficient and perfect product development process can improve development efficiency and reduce costs. DQE needs to conduct in - depth analysis of the existing process, identify its deficiencies, and propose improvement plans. At the same time, it is necessary to ensure the integrity and compliance of the product development process, documents, and records. This means that all development processes should have detailed documentation records. These records are not only proof of product quality but also important basis for subsequent improvement and optimization.
2. At each stage of project development, DQE needs to set APQP quality objectives (CTQ, SMI, Cpk) and quality plans. CTQ (Critical to Quality) defines the key requirements that the product must meet; SMI (Statistical Measurement Index) is used to measure the stability and capability of the process; Cpk (Process Capability Index) reflects the degree to which the process meets the quality requirements. Develop relevant quality technical documents for development. These documents serve as the guiding manuals for project development, ensuring that each link can be carried out in accordance with the established quality standards.

(III) Problem Solving
Following up, promoting, and ensuring the timely resolution of design issues (such as test problems, ART failures, PR/PiR/MP issues) is a key task for DQE. In the product development process, various problems are inevitable. DQE needs to promptly follow up on the progress of resolving these problems, coordinate resources from all parties, and promote the resolution of the problems. For test problems, it is necessary to analyze the causes of the problems and formulate solutions; for ART failures, it is necessary to find out the root causes of the failures and take corresponding measures for improvement; for PR/PiR/MP issues, it is necessary to ensure that the issues are properly handled without affecting the normal development and launch of the products.

(VIII) Market awareness and risk assessment
1. Having a very good market awareness and being able to evaluate and measure products from the perspective of customer usage is an important quality for DQE. In the product design process, full consideration should be given to customers' needs and usage habits to ensure that the product has a good user experience. Only by meeting customers' needs can a product succeed in the market.
2. Be familiar with testing, evaluate various possibilities, including risks under abnormal user usage conditions, etc., and be able to analyze the acceleration factors of accelerated aging tests. Through the evaluation of various possibilities, potential problems that may occur during the product's use can be discovered in advance, and corresponding preventive measures can be taken. Analyzing the acceleration factors of accelerated aging tests can help understand the aging laws of products under different environmental conditions, providing a basis for the reliability design of products.
